The value added of publishing in Mexico has shown a steady growth from 2013 to 2023, growing from 17.95 billion to 25.83 billion Mexican Pesos, emphasizing its resilience despite minor fluctuations. Notable yearly variations include significant growth periods in 2015 (7.82%) and declines in 2018 (-1.43%), maintaining an overall robust performance with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 2.9% by 2023.
Forecast data from 2024 to 2028 anticipates a continued increase, albeit at a slower pace, with the value projected to reach 28.71 billion Mexican Pesos by 2028. The forecasted 5-year CAGR is 1.67%, indicating a moderate but consistent growth trajectory.
